C.W. Sturgeon

Saturday May 16th

Hailing from the heart of Texas, CW Sturgeon blends timeless country sounds with electrifying live performances. With roots in Southern Gospel, Bluegrass, and years of experience gracing legendary stages like the Grand Ole Opry, CW brings authenticity and charisma to every performance. CW and his band deliver a dynamic mix of classic country, western swing, and honky-tonk favorites, infused with their unique style. Headlining weekly at Little Red’s Longhorn Saloon in the Fort Worth Stockyards, CW has become a staple in the local dancehall music scene and a must-see act for fans of traditional country music. Whether you’re two-stepping on a Texas hardwood floor or just soaking in the nostalgia of a Ray Price shuffle, CW Sturgeon and his band ensure every performance feels like a trip back to the golden age of country music while throwing in a few originals and a dash of 90's, and other crowd favorites.

Scott Sean White is a touring singer-songwriter who has had several songs recorded by country superstar Cody Johnson - two on Cody’s album “Human” - including “God Bless the Boy” and “Made a Home,” and one called “Over Missing You” on Cody’s latest album - the deluxe version of “Leather.”

Scott plays 120-150 shows a year at house concerts and listening rooms all over the country, and has also had several songs recorded by Bryan Martin as well, including “Years in the Making,” “Poets and Old Souls,” and “Wishbone.” Jack Ingram said, “Some songwriters spend precious time struggling to find their truth and make it rhyme. Others just pick up their guitar and tell it. Scott Sean White is one of the others.”

He is a storyteller, both in his songs, and the moments in-between songs, laying out his life experience - his faith and struggles - and intertwining it all with his craft. His live show is starkly honest, transparent, and eye-opening - full of laughter and probably a few (good) tears, too.

2024 Texas Country Music Association Roots / Alternative Group of the Year

Before there was Americana, before there was Texas Country, Two Tons of Steel front man Kevin Geil and his original band, "Dead Crickets," rocked a sound that blended the best of musical worlds and pushed the envelope of "Texas" sound with a signature brand of high-energy country. The group released "Gone" in mid 2018 and won the Ameripolitan Honky Tonk Group of the Year in 2019. The San Antonio-based group packed the small bars and local hangouts and quickly became the Alamo City's most-loved band, earning them a spot on the cover of Billboard Magazine. It was the beginning of a twenty year journey for Geil and the 4-piece ensemble. Releasing "Two Tons Of Steel" in 1994 and "Crazy For My Baby" in 1995 on Blue Fire Records, a sponsorship deal with Lone Star Beer quickly followed. Dead Crickets, renamed Two Tons of Steel in 1996 began traveling outside of Texas, including stops at the Grand Ole' Opry in Nashville, Tenn., the National Theater in Havana, Cuba, and European tours, to greet fans who had embraced their Texas-born sound. In 1996 they released "Oh No!" on their independent label, "Big Bellied Records." They followed up the passion project with a live recording at the legendary Gruene Hall in Gruene, Texas, taped during a Two Ton Tuesday Show 1998. In 2023, the band will mark 27 years of "Two Ton Tuesday Live from Gruene Hall." The summer- long event has drawn over 275,000 fans since it began its annual run in 1995. The popular concert series was captured in "Two Ton Tuesday Live," a DVD-CD combo released on Palo Duro Records in 2006. Also that year, the band's first national release, "Vegas," produced by Grammy Award-winning producer Lloyd Maines on the Palo Duro label, took them to No. 7 on the Americana Music Charts and was one of the top 20 releases of 2006. Two Tons released "Not That Lucky" in 2009. The album peaked at No. 4 on the Americana Music Charts and has made Two Tons of Steel a legend on the Texas Music Scene. Along the way, the band has collected a number of awards. To date, Two Tons has cleaned up at home, winning "Band of the Year" on 12 separate occasions and "Album of the Year" for its self-titled debut. Two Tons has also been named "Best Country Band" by the San Antonio Current ten times. Geil also has nabbed 'Best Male Vocal' honors four times. Two Tons of Steel's reach extends beyond their live gigs. The band was filmed during a "Two Ton Tuesday" gig for the IMAX film, "Texas: The Big Picture," which can be seen daily at the IMAX Theatre in the Bob Bullock Texas State History Museum in Austin and has been seen as far away as Japan. The band also has been featured as supporting characters in award- winning author Karen Kendall's romance novel, "First Date." Two Tons Of Steel, Kevin Geil, JD Larish on Bass, Stephen James on Lead Guitar and Rich Alcorta on Drums preform about 200 shows a year and are currently on tour supporting "Gone" there 12th release.

  Monte picked up a guitar at the age of 12, learning his first chords from his mother, Maggie, at the age of 13. 

 He first gained notoriety in 1999 in Austin, Texas, when he delivered a jaw-dropping live performance on an episode of the PBS series Austin City Limits. 

 He has been named one of the "Top 50 All-Time Greatest Guitar Players" by Guitar Player Magazine. 

 He won the "Best Acoustic Guitar Player" Award at the Austin Chronicle's Austin Music Awards seven years in a row. As a songwriter, he has put out 12 cds since 1993. 

 Currently and for the las 9 seasons, Monte is the composer/creator of music for the FOX TV series Last Man Standing, starring Tim Allen. 

 In 2014, German amp manufacturer AER teamed up to develop a new signature MM200 acoustic amp. in 2008, Monte appeared on Live from Daryl's House with Hall and Oates frontman, Daryl Hall. 

In 2004, Alvarez Guitars created the MMY1 Monte Montgomery Signature Guitar, a model based on Montgomery's 1987 Alvarez-Yairi DY62C Acoustic-Electric Guitar.
